Fresh Market Update: What’s Looking Good This Week | Week Ending 5 July

There is plenty to love in fresh this week, with winter favourites, great-value staples and beautiful seasonal produce arriving across Earth Markets stores.

From comforting Kent pumpkin and bargain baby broccoli to sweet Imperial mandarins and creamy avocados, here is what our buyers are seeing in market this week.

Winter favourites at great value

Colder nights call for proper winter cooking, and Whole Kent Pumpkin is one of the standout buys this weekend at just 99c/kg. It is perfect for soups, roasting, mash, curries or a simple tray of roast vegetables. Stores have ordered plenty, so expect to see it filling plenty of baskets and trolleys over the coming days.

Baby broccoli is also proving to be excellent value, with 3 bunches for $5 this weekend. Broccoli supply remains tight, but baby broccoli is abundant, delicious and a great alternative for stir-fries, roasting, salads or serving alongside a winter dinner.

Citrus season is here

Southern States Imperial Mandarins have now arrived for the season, with fruit quality continuing to improve. This week, smaller mandarins are on special at $2.99 for a 1kg bag, making them an easy addition to lunchboxes, snack bowls and winter fruit platters.

Corn and celery are also continuing to offer exceptional value, currently sitting around 60 to 70 per cent lower than the same period last winter. With strong supply and fantastic quality, these are two produce staples worth adding to your trolley this week.

Berries and avocados worth picking up

Local berry supply remains strong, keeping strawberries and raspberries at great value. Blueberry prices have also started to ease, with even more exciting specials expected soon.

For avocado lovers, Earth Markets is currently ranging both traditional Hass avocados and premium Greenskin Reed avocados. Hass avocados are excellent value at 3 for $5, while Reed avocados are larger in size with a rich, buttery and nutty flavour that makes them especially beautiful in salads, smashed on toast or served simply with lemon, chilli and sea salt.

A quick market note

Iceberg lettuce has been in short supply this week, which has temporarily pushed pricing up after several months of cheaper lettuce. The good news is supply is expected to improve from mid-week next week, with pricing anticipated to ease as the week progresses.
